Startup Puts AI Agents in Spreadsheets
Meridian emerged from stealth mode and announced a $17 million (approximately ₩17 billion) investment.[TechCrunch] Their goal is to completely rebuild the traditional spreadsheet based on AI agents. Led by CEO John Ling, COO Zach Kirshner, and CTO George Fang.[TechCrunch]
The key is the IDE approach. Instead of cell-by-cell work like Excel, they build financial models like a code editor. AI agents automate repetitive tasks.
AI Spreadsheet Competition Intensifies
Attempts to incorporate AI into spreadsheets continue. In 2025, former MS executives founded a startup to replace Excel-based financial tasks with AI.[TechCrunch] Meridian’s differentiator is that it’s designed agent-centric from the start, rather than adding AI to existing sheets.
The Weight of ₩17 Billion
The spreadsheet market is dominated by MS and Google. However, companies are rapidly adopting AI tools, and the demand for financial automation is high. If Meridian creates tools tailored to the workflows of financial professionals, they can grow in a niche market. However, the actual performance remains to be seen as there are no product demos or pricing information available yet.
